SQL injection in SourceCodester Dynamic Input Field Generator Using HTML, CSS, and PHP 1.0 exposes the saveUser function at /public/submit.php to database manipulation through the unsanitized Researcher parameter. The CVSS 4.0 score of 5.3 with PR:L indicates low-privileged authentication is required, limiting but not eliminating risk. A public proof-of-concept exploit is available via a referenced GitHub gist, and no vendor-released patch has been identified at time of analysis.
Cross-Site Request Forgery in SourceCodester Dynamic Input Field Generator Using HTML, CSS, and PHP 1.0 allows remote attackers to perform unauthorized state-changing actions on behalf of authenticated users without their knowledge. The attack requires passive victim interaction (UI:P per CVSS 4.0) - a logged-in user must be lured to a malicious page that silently submits forged requests to the application. A public proof-of-concept exploit is available on GitHub, lowering the technical barrier for abuse; however, no CISA KEV listing exists and impact is constrained to low integrity degradation with no confidentiality or availability consequence.
